Web16 Mar 2024 · Phidias (or Pheidias) was perhaps the most celebrated artist of Greece’s golden age. An Athenian, Phidias lived during the time of Pericles in the mid-fifth century BC, when Athens’ power and cultural influence was at its height. Its decorative sculptures are considered some of the high points of Greek art, an enduring symbol of Ancient Greece, democracy and Western civilization. The Parthenon was built in thanksgiving for the Hellenic victory over Persian invaders during the Greco-Persian Wars. Like most Greek temples, the Parthenon also served as the city treasury.
